The nurse is caring for a newborn of Jewish descent who has an inborn error of metabolism in which the child becomes hypotonic and loses vision. What genetic disorder is this newborn manifesting?
 
  A) Fragile X syndrome
  B) Hemophilia
  C) Tay-Sachs disease
  D) Duchenne muscular dystrophy

Answer to Question 1

C
Feedback:
Tay-Sachs disease is an inborn error of metabolism, primarily affecting children of Ashkenazi Jewish descent. Symptoms begin at about 1 year of age. The child becomes hypotonic and loses vision. Death usually occurs before 4 years of age. Fragile X syndrome is a genetic, sex-linked abnormality of the X chromosome that results in cognitive impairment and distinctive physical features. Hemophilia is a blood clotting disorder, and Duchenne muscular dystrophy is the most common degenerative muscular disorder in children.
